JOB SEARCH AND JOB MATCHING COURSE OUTLINE YVES ZENOU

1. Some empirical facts on flows in the labor market 2. The competitive model without frictions ¾ Equilibrium ¾ Welfare ¾ Exercise 1 3. The basic job search model ¾ Equilibrium ¾ Exercise 2 4. The basic job matching model ¾ Equilibrium ¾ Welfare ¾ Dynamics ¾ Exercises 3 and 4 5. Workers’ and jobs’ heterogeneity ¾ Endogenous job destruction ¾ Stochastic job matching ¾ The model of Marimon-Zilibotti 6. God and bad jobs and on-the-job search ¾ The model of Dolado, Jansen, and Jimeno. ¾ Exercise 5 7. Wage posting models ¾ The Diamond paradox ¾ The model of Burdett-Mortensen ¾ Burdett-Mortensen meet Pissarides 8. Multiple equilibria in search-matching models ¾ Some results ¾ Exercise 6
